CPointer CObjects::Get(char* szObjectName)
{
	CBaseObject*	pvObject;
	CPointer		pObject;

	pvObject = GetFromMemory(szObjectName);
	if (pvObject)
	{
		pObject.AssignObject(pvObject);
		return pObject;
	}

	pvObject = GetFromDatabase(szObjectName);
	if (pvObject)
	{
		pObject.AssignObject(pvObject);
		return pObject;
	}

	pvObject = GetFromSources(szObjectName);
	if (pvObject)
	{
		pObject.AssignObject(pvObject);
		return pObject;
	}

	return Null();
}

BOOL CObjects::Flush(BOOL bClearMemory, BOOL bClearCache)
{
	SIndexesIterator	sIter;
	OIndex				oi;
	BOOL				bResult;
	CBaseObject*		pcBaseObject;

	if (mbDatabase)
	{
		bResult = TRUE;
		oi = StartMemoryIteration(&sIter);
		while (oi != INVALID_O_INDEX)
		{
			pcBaseObject = GetFromMemory(oi);
			bResult &= Save(pcBaseObject);
			oi = IterateMemory(&sIter);
		}

		if (bClearMemory)
		{
			bResult &= ClearMemory();
		}

		bResult &= mcDatabase.Flush(bClearCache);
		return bResult;
	}
	else
	{
		bResult = ClearMemory();
		return bResult;
	}
}

BOOL CObjects::ClearMemory(void)
{
	SIndexesIterator		sIter;
	OIndex					oi;
	CBaseObject*			pcBaseObject;
	CArrayBlockObjectPtr		apcBaseObjects;
	int						iCount;

	apcBaseObjects.Init(CLEAR_MEMORY_CHUNK_SIZE);
	oi = StartMemoryIteration(&sIter);

	iCount = 0;
	while (oi != INVALID_O_INDEX)
	{
		pcBaseObject = GetFromMemory(oi);
		apcBaseObjects.Add(&pcBaseObject);
		iCount++;

		if (iCount == CLEAR_MEMORY_CHUNK_SIZE)
		{
			KillDontFreeObjects(&apcBaseObjects);
			FreeObjects(&apcBaseObjects);

			iCount = 0;
			apcBaseObjects.ReInit();
		}

		oi = IterateMemory(&sIter);
	}

	KillDontFreeObjects(&apcBaseObjects);
	FreeObjects(&apcBaseObjects);

	apcBaseObjects.Kill();

	mcMemory.ReInit();
	return TRUE;
}
